Transaction ec9d32e7a5d616868826591f2bda0429a2eaeb6765910690c4c7de8795febb10
1 Input
1 Output
-
ec9d32e7a5d616868826591f2bda0429a2eaeb6765910690c4c7de8795febb10:0
- value
- 4934650
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6bb5c88552aca21fcdf16d8d6ece3adddf76c81373a04eae7c4447d34bb74c38
- address
- bc1pdw6u3p2j4j3pln03dkxkan36mh0hdjqnwwsyatnug3raxjahfsuql9zp4d